Ruth Hill, age 101, passed away on November 26, 2025, in Salt Lake City, Utah. She was born on September 3, 1924, in Paris, Idaho.
Ruth married the love of her life, James LaVere Hill. She had a passion for gardening, but her greatest joy was the memorable trips she took to Wendover with her son Glen and his wife Becky, where she often returned home a winner. Above all, Ruth’s proudest achievement was raising her four children, whom she cherished deeply.
Ruth is survived by her children: Ron (Kathy), Paul (Sue), Glen (Becky), and Shauna (Jeff) Ericson; her nine grandchildren; and her fourteen great-grandchildren.
She is preceded in death by her husband, James LaVere Hill, and her grandson, Joshua Hill.
Family and friends may visit at a viewing on Thursday, December 4, 2025, from 1:00 to 2:45 PM at Memorial Redwood Mortuary, 6500 South Redwood Road, West Jordan, Utah.
A graveside service will follow at 3:00 PM at Memorial Redwood Cemetery, at the same location.
